What Is Business Organization Law?
There are different types of business structures that affect how you run your company. Some business structures are less expensive to get up and running and have simpler reporting requirements. Other business organizations have greater tax advantages but have stricter requirements. Different types of business organizations include:
- Sole proprietorship
- Limited liability company (LLC)
- Partnership and limited liability partnership (LLP)
- Corporation
- S corporation or B corporation
- Non-profit organization

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Business Organizations Lawyer?
If you don’t follow the proper filing, recordkeeping, and corporate structure requirements, it can cause trouble down the road. Working with a business organization lawyer can help you avoid many of the common pitfalls of running a business. There can be serious legal and financial consequences when your business doesn’t follow the strict corporate requirements, including:
- Tax violations
- IRS audits
- Securities law violations
- Personal liability for business losses
- Loss of business reputation
